如今,在数字化浪潮中,软件开发服务显得尤为关键。这种服务有助于企业实现转型与革新,根据需求方的要求,定制具备不同功能的软件。这些软件覆盖了金融、医疗等多个领域。而软件的开发质量和效率,则是其能否成功满足需求的核心因素。
软件品质是开发工作的关键所在。首先,若代码质量不佳,软件将漏洞频现。例如,运行时可能会出现卡顿、崩溃等问题,严重损害用户的使用体验。其次,安全风险同样不容小觑。一旦软件存在安全漏洞,用户的个人信息将面临风险,进而可能损害企业声誉,导致客户流失。
开发流程
流程的明确程度会显著影响开发速度。首先,需求调研至关重要,必须准确领会客户的需求。一旦理解出现偏差,后续的开发工作可能会误入歧途。再者,开发过程中的迭代调整也不可或缺。缺乏有效的反馈和改进机制,最终的产品可能无法达到预期的效果。
团队协作
软件开发中,协作至关重要。优秀的团队可以互相补充。资深程序员能指导新手,新手亦能带来新思路。然而,若团队成员间沟通不畅,误解在所难免。例如,接口定义模糊,便可能引发功能衔接上的难题。
成本效益
考量成本与收益的平衡至关重要。首先,合理的资金投入是项目顺利进行的关键。比如,虽然高薪聘请有才能的开发者成本较高,但能保证产品质量。其次,需根据实际需求来控制成本。若研发出的软件价格高昂却实用性不强,便难以获得市场的认可。